Ottomancer v0.12
A free 2D particle editor that speaks an animator's language.
Open the editor ☕ Buy me a coffeeRuns entirely in your browser. Nothing to install, nothing uploaded — your projects never leave your machine. After the first visit it works offline, and your browser can install it as an app.
What it does
- A professional animator's timeline: dope sheet, keyframes, curves with their own editor, loop region, animation variants.
- Modular emitter system — emission, shape, color/size over lifetime, noise, trails, texture-sheet (flipbook) animation.
- 75 ready-made effects across nine categories — fire, magic, water, cartoon, win/celebration loops, matrix rain, comets — every one an ordinary emitter you can pull apart and make yours.
- 57 built-in sprites including animated 4×4 sheets and seamless loop sheets for glows, rays and shines.
- Every export you need: Spine-compatible JSON + atlas + PNG that drops straight into game engines, PNG sequences, WebM and MP4 video, animated WebP and GIF, SVG, and a compact web bundle with its own player.
